
Chris Bretherton
Professor, Department of Atmospheric Sciences and Department of Applied Mathematics
Weather
Expertise: Clouds, atmospheric convection, and their roles in climate and climate change
Chris Bretherton is an atmospheric scientist who studies cloud formation and turbulence, and improves how they are simulated in global climate and weather forecast models. His research includes participating in field experiments and observational analyses, three-dimensional modeling of fluid flow in and around fields of clouds, and understanding how clouds will respond to and feed back on climate change.
